Razorbacks advance in ITA

FAYETTEVILLE – The three Razorbacks playing in the qualifying round of the USTA/ITA Central Regional Championship being hosted this week by Arkansas combined for four victories on Thursday’s first day of the tournament.

Valentina Starkova posted a 6-1, 6-2 win over Anastacia Simons of Southern Illinois and a 6-2, 7-6 (5) win over Jenny Nalepa of Saint Louis.

Jade Frampton beat DePaul’s Earlynn Lauer, 6-2, 6-0, and Claudine Paulson knocked off Caitlin McKenna of Saint Louis, 6-1, 6-2.

"Obviously we had a lot of great starts to matches today, which gave us the advantage to go four-up and none down for the day," head coach Michael Hegarty said. "That will be the key again Friday as the opposition gets stronger."

Starkova, Frampton and Paulson will be joined by several Razorbacks seeded into Friday’s main draw.

Senior Anouk Tigu is No. 1 overall and junior Kate Lukomskaya is No. 7. Junior Emily Carbone is in the alphabetical 9-16 listing of seeds.

Eight Razorbacks are participating in the main draw of the singles tournament, which is the most in program history.

In doubles, Tigu and Paulson are seeded No. 2 overall, and Lukomskaya and Kelsey Sundaram are in the alphabetical 9-16 listing.

Play begins Friday at 8:30 a.m. at the Dills Indoor Stadium and the Billingsley Center.

The tournament runs through Monday.

The singles and doubles winner automatically qualify for the national tournament next month in New York.
